In the morning, enjoy a relaxing swim at the resort's private beach followed by a delicious breakfast at their restaurant. In the afternoon, explore the historic Fort Aguada, which was built in the 17th century by the Portuguese to defend against Dutch and Maratha invasions. Visit the lighthouse for stunning views of the Arabian Sea. In the evening, relax at the resort's bar with a refreshing drink and enjoy the sunset.
In the morning, take a scenic drive to Dudhsagar Falls, one of the tallest waterfalls in India. Take a dip in the cool waters or hike to the top for breathtaking views. Pack a picnic lunch to enjoy in the beautiful natural surroundings. In the afternoon, visit the nearby spice plantations to learn about the different spices grown in Goa and enjoy a traditional Goan lunch. In the evening, return to Fort Aguada Beach Resort for a relaxing evening by the beach.
In the morning, visit the beautiful Basilica of Bom Jesus,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the oldest churches in Goa. Then, head to Fontainhas, the Latin Quarter of Panaji city, to explore the colorful Portuguese-style houses and quaint streets. Stop for lunch at a local restaurant for some delicious seafood. In the afternoon, visit the Goa State Museum to learn about the history and culture of Goa. In the evening, enjoy a sunset cruise along the Mandovi River and end the day with some live music and drinks at a local bar.
Don't miss the chance to try some authentic Goan food, such as fish curry, pork vindaloo, and bebinca. You can also take a day trip to the beautiful beaches of South Goa, such as Palolem and Agonda. For adventure seekers, try water sports activities like jet skiing, parasailing, and scuba diving. Don't forget to visit the famous Saturday Night Market in Arpora for some shopping and nightlife. And if you have time, take a trip to the neighboring state of Karnataka to visit the beautiful Gokarna beach.
